Install Minecraft Forge. Download the right version of Forge from one of the links above. Run the downloaded .jar file (you must have java installed) A window opens, click on the OK button. Launch the Minecraft launcher. Select the Forge profile on the launcher.

Make sure the Minecraft install location is correct. By default, your Minecraft install location should be “C:\Users\[username]\AppData\Roaming\.minecraft” on Windows. If the path listed at the bottom of the installer window isn’t correct, click … to the right of the path. Then navigate to the Minecraft install folder and click Open.
